    Abstract: A multi-chamber single-use bioreactor for cell culture expansion has bag assembly and a rigid support structure defining a bag receiving space. The bag assembly disposed in the bag receiving space of the rigid support structure and supported by the rigid support structure. The bag assembly has at least a first flexible bag and a second flexible bag. The first bag defines a first reaction chamber, and the second bag defines a second reaction chamber. The first reaction chamber has a first volume, a first inlet, and a first outlet, and the second reaction chamber has a second volume different from the first volume, a second inlet, and a second outlet. The second inlet of the second bag is fluidically connected to the first outlet of the first bag so liquid in first reaction chamber can be transferred to the second reaction chamber.

    Abstract: Biocatalytic conversion systems and methods of producing and using same that have improved yields are disclosed. The systems and methods involve co-fermentation of sugars and gaseous substrates for alcohol, ketone, and/or organic acid production. The systems and methods may include biocatalytically converting at least one sugar substrate into at least one of alcohol, at least one ketone, and/or at least one organic acid. The systems and methods may further include biocatalytically converting gases that comprise CO 2 and H 2 to at least one alcohol and/or at least one organic acid, thereby adding extra revenue to biorefineries.

    Abstract: This invention relates generally to luminescence techniques for imaging radiation fields and, more specifically, to the use of experimental and mathematical methods to distinguish between dynamic irradiation and static - or other abnormal radiation - exposure conditions for applications in personnel and environmental radiation dosimetry, or related fields. In more particular, the instant invention provides a rapid and reliable method of detecting abnormal dosimeter exposure conditions over a wide dynamic range of radiation doses, while avoiding significant background interference and stimulation light leakage. Additionally, the preferred embodiment of the instant invention uses a pulsed and synchronized luminescence detection scheme. Further, this invention teaches a complete method and system for abnormal exposure detection - including the use of a luminescent thin powder layer, the use of a periodic radiation absorbing filter, the pulsed stimulation and synchronized luminescence detection scheme, and the method of analyzing and interpreting the recorded images. Finally, the system provides a means of mathematically characterizing an image as containing either a normal or abnormal exposure.
